Choosing the Right Robot Vacuum with Mop for Wood Floors
Understanding Suction Power
Suction power, measured in Pascals (Pa), is a critical factor, especially if you have carpets or pets. Higher suction (6000Pa and above) means the robot can lift more dirt, dust, and debris from both hard floors and carpets. For primarily wood floors, a mid-range suction (4000-6000Pa) is often sufficient, but if you have area rugs, opting for higher suction provides more versatility. Lower suction might struggle with embedded dirt, requiring multiple passes. Consider your floor type breakdown – more carpet = higher Pa needed.
Navigational Intelligence & Mapping
How a robot vacuum “sees” your home significantly impacts its efficiency. LiDAR (Light Detection and Ranging) navigation is a standout feature. Robots with LiDAR create detailed maps of your home, allowing for systematic cleaning paths, efficient room-to-room transitions, and the ability to set virtual boundaries (no-go zones). This is far superior to random bounce-around patterns. Smart Mapping takes this a step further, allowing you to save multiple floor plans, which is essential for multi-story homes. Without good navigation, the robot will waste time and may miss spots.
Mopping System Capabilities
Robot vacuums with mopping functions vary greatly. Look beyond just the presence of a mop; consider how it mops. Water tank capacity is important – larger tanks mean less frequent refills. Adjustable water flow is crucial for different floor types; you don’t want to soak wood floors! Rotating mop pads (often described by RPM – revolutions per minute) provide more effective scrubbing action than simple dragging. Some models feature hot air drying to prevent mildew and odors in the mop pad. Pay attention to whether the mop lifts when encountering carpets to prevent wetting.
Self-Emptying Base Benefits
A self-emptying base is a game-changer for convenience. These bases automatically suck dirt and debris from the robot’s dustbin into a larger, sealed bag. This means you don’t need to empty the robot after every use – some bases hold weeks’ worth of debris. However, consider the dust bag capacity and cost of replacement bags. Larger capacity bases are more convenient, but bags will eventually need replacing. Some also offer self-washing and drying mop features.
